Austrian Moritz Zdekauer Porcelain Rose Plate
About the Item
A porcelain plate with pink roses and a gilded beaded border, by M&Z Austria, circa 1900.
“M&Z Austria” porcelain was produced by Moritz Zdekauer in Altrohlau, Austria, now part of the Czech Republic, from 1884-1909.
They are known for their lavish floral patterns with gold decoration.
A shaped and beaded rim in an iridescent pale blue ground fading towards the center which shows a hand-painted bouquet of pink and yellow roses.
An eight lobed mold, each with a single hand painted rose.
Beautiful hung on the wall in a romantic room setting.
8.75 inches in Diameter x 1.25 inches H
